Q: How does the Fareline pricing experiment affect my review of checkout changes? A: The experiment splits buyers into three price-display cohorts via the Tessera assignment service. Any change touching price rendering must read cohort from the request context, never recompute it, or you'll contaminate the experiment. Reject PRs that hardcode cohort values or bypass the assignment call. Variant definitions, holdout rules, and the analysis plan are maintained on the internal page below.

wiki page, tahaf-tajog: https://jira.ordindyn.corp/pipeline

Quarterly Planning Note — Divestiture of the Coastal Tooling Unit

For the finance team: the sale of the Coastal Tooling unit to Pellmark Industries remains on track for close in Q3. Please finalize the carve-out balance sheet, reconcile intercompany positions, and prepare the working-capital adjustment schedule by month-end. Audit support requests should be prioritized. For planning purposes, note the following sensitive item:

internal memo for hawef-kahif: The finance team signed off on a budget of $25.9 million for Project Sorox. The renewal with Pelokek Logistics closes at $51.7 million a year, 52 percent below the last contract.

Welcome to Hartwell & Pryce. From Monday, the newly fitted Level 6 at our Corven Street office opens to staff and escorted visitors. All guests must sign in at the Level 1 reception, wear a printed visitor lanyard at all times, and remain accompanied by their host, including in kitchenettes and breakout areas. Visitors may not be left alone near the project walls in the east wing. New starters escorting guests to Level 6 should use the code below at the stairwell door.

badge for fafop-fajof: bdg-Z-47